Microsoft Layoffs 2025

  • Layoff Details: Microsoft is cutting approximately 6,000 employees (3% of its global workforce) in May 2025 across various teams, including LinkedIn and Xbox.
  • Strategic Focus: The layoffs aim to reduce management layers and streamline operations, aligning with a broader industry trend toward cost-cutting and refocusing on AI and cloud computing.
  • Historical Context: This is Microsoft's largest layoff since the 10,000 jobs cut in 2023.
  • Financial Position: The company reported a strong quarterly net income of $25.8 billion, indicating financial health despite the layoffs.
  • AI Investment: Microsoft is investing $80 billion in AI, signaling long-term strategic priorities.
  • Analyst Insights: Analysts suggest potential further cuts to offset AI-related capital expenditures.

Microsoft Authenticator App Changes

  • Feature Phase-Out: The password storage and autofill feature will be phased out by June 2025, with all passwords inaccessible by August 2025.
  • Autofill Transfer: Autofill functionality is being transferred to the Edge browser, requiring users to migrate data before deadlines.
  • Shift to Passkeys: Microsoft recommends using Passkeys instead of traditional passwords, aligning with industry trends toward enhanced security.

TeKnowledge Expansion in Africa

  • Geographic Focus: TeKnowledge is expanding operations in Nigeria and other African regions.
  • Service Offerings: The company is leveraging AI-first technology services to grow its workforce, aiming for over 6,000 employees in the region.
  • Market Impact: This move reflects growing demand for tech solutions in Africa and could intensify competition in the region.

Microsoft Edge Browser Changes

  • Feature Removals: The Edge beta will remove Wallet Hub, Mini menu, Image Editor, Image Hover menu, and Video Super Resolution functions.
  • Strategic Rationalization: These changes suggest a focus on core functionalities and integration with other Microsoft products like the Authenticator app.
